IP查询
查询
你查询的IP:[59.32.35.208] 地理位置:中国–广东–河源
最新查询
202.16.176.168
118.126.174.47
119.128.84.255
118.224.158.39
122.119.222.54
60.200.39.3
202.12.110.125
221.224.91.199
119.108.238.247
59.32.35.208
118.88.64.176
210.5.160.252
202.38.168.174
211.160.96.115
116.215.139.135
116.193.16.120
59.32.212.232
118.230.41.254
114.60.175.93
116.196.202.190
221.199.128.29
202.46.32.2
203.81.16.71
124.66.208.210
220.112.193.132
218.185.192.241
119.18.208.199
202.91.176.224
122.192.197.116
119.20.95.213
116.4.168.131